SPIP-Contrib

SPIP-Contrib

عربي | Deutsch | English | Español | français | italiano

246 Plugins, 178 contribs sur SPIP-Zone, 223 visiteurs en ce moment

Accueil du site > Squelettes > Squelettes pour blog > The Morning After > The Morning After

The Morning After

5 décembre 2008 – par ashaszin, Valéry – 220 commentaires

Toutes les versions de cet article : [Español] [français]

31 votes

Squelettes prêts à l’emploi, pour site de type weblog. The Morning After est un squelette adapté d’un thème Wordpress partagé sous licence MIT.

Introduction

Le thème d’origine est téléchargeable sur Google code. Son auteur est Arun Kale [1].

Il se base sur le framework CSS Blueprint ce qui assure un bon niveau de compatibilité entre les navigateurs. Le doctype est XHTML 1.0 Transitional.

La licence du thème d’origine est MIT [2] Mise à jour :

L’adaptation a été réalisée pour SPIP 2.0. Quelques légères adaptations devraient le rendre compatible avec les versions antérieures.

Un site de démonstration est disponible ici : Squelette The Morning After.

Caractéristiques

Le paquet comprends les squelettes suivants :

-  sommaire
-  rubrique
-  article
-  auteur
-  mot
-  plan
-  recherche
-  archives (tous les billets du site avec pagination)

Pour l’essentiel, les boucles présentes dans les squelettes sont reprises de celles de la dist. L’article propose donc par exemple l’affichage des documents joints, du portfolio, etc.

La page d’accueil comporte :

-  le dernier article
-  un article sélectionné par mot-clé
-  les dernières brèves
-  la liste des derniers articles
-  un encart publicitaire optionnel
-  un nuage de mots clé (nécéssite le plugin Nuage)
-  les derniers commentaires

Le dernier article est affiché au format 470px × 175px. Les images plus grandes seront mises à ce format. L’effet est donc optimal si on utilise de grandes images horizontales pour illustrer les posts.

Le multilinguisme n’est pas géré mais le squelette peut être utilisé en français ou en anglais, les deux fichiers de langue étant fournis.

Les plugins

Les squelettes The Morning After pour SPIP sont compatibles avec plusieurs plugins.

Les balises nécessaires à leur utilisation sont présentes dans les squelettes. Ceux-ci peuvent toutefois être utilisé sans activer le moindre plugin grâce à l’utilisation de la nouvelle balise #PLUGIN de SPIP 2.0.

Les plugins utilisables sont les suivants :

-  Crayons : édition rapide depuis les pages publi­ques du site.
-  Nuage : afficher les mots-clés en faisant varier la taille de la police (page d’accueil, dans la seconde colonne). Aucun groupe de mot clé n’a été défini.
-  Social tags : per­met d’ajou­ter des icô­nes de par­tage de liens vers les sites tels que Digg, Facebook, Delicious.... (page article).
-  CFG : Permet de configurer le squelette (la "baseline" pour la version stable et le style graphique du site (version de dev. à venir) ).

Je préconise par ailleurs l’utilisation des plugins les plus utiles habituels.

Installation et configuration

L’installation consiste simplement à déposer le répertoire squelettes à la racine du site par FTP.

Le squelette sera alors immédiatement actif.

Pour en profiter pleinement, vous devez toutefois activer brèves et mots clés Dans la configuration de SPIP, ainsi qu’une méthode de fabrication des vignettes dans les fonctions avancées.

-  Article sélectionné : créer un groupe de mots-clés au nom indifférent et ajoutez-y un mot clé intitulé "featured".
-  Nuage de tags : ajoutez et activez le plugin "Nuage" (disponible dans la liste SPIP-Contrib dans l’espace privé). Pour exclure le mot "featured", par vous devrez modifier le squelette sommaire.html [3].
-  Publicité : décommentez la ligne <INCLURE{fond=inc-ad_home}> sur sommaire.html pour l’afficher. Par défaut, il s’agit du logo de spip.net et d’un lien vers ce site.

Personnalisation

La personnalisation implique de savoir préparer une image pour le web. Trois images sont nécessaires pour personnaliser le site :

-  squelettes/images/bg/home_banner.png pour la page d’accueil
-  squelettes/images/bg/archive_banner.png pour les rubriques et la page archives
-  squelettes/images/bg/single_banner.png pour les articles.

Vous pouvez aussi utiliser la même image partout avec trois noms différents.

Le logo du site SPIP importé par l’onglet Configuration de l’espace privé s’affichera aux dimensions maximales de 535x90px.

Pour personnaliser la publicité (format 250 X 250 px), modifiez le fichier inc-ad_home.html

Enfin, vous pouvez ajouter une feuille de style perso.css surcharger la feuille de style du site et ajouter par exemple des couleurs.

Les évolutions possibles du squelette

Le squelette est disponible sur SPIP-zone. Vous pouvez donc participer à son évolution : svn ://zone.spip.org/spip-zone/_squelettes_/the_morning_after

Cette version 1 est une adaptation la plus fidèle possible du thème Wordpress d’origine. Dans ce contexte les améliorations suivantes peuvent être apportées [4] :

-  pouvoir utiliser le plugin CFG (lequel deviendra alors sans doute nécessaire) ;
-  configuration du groupe de mot clé à afficher dans Nuage (avec CFG)
-  ajout d’un champs de saisie d’une accroche (baseline) pour afficher sous le nom du site (actuellement : reprend #DESCRIPTION ;
-  activation et personnalisation de la publicité par le backoffice.

Les évolutions possibles sont les suivantes pour une version 2 :

-  ajout d’une blogroll (liste de sites référencés) ;
-  utilisation des microformats dans le code (X)HTML ; (ok pour auteurs)
-  création de variantes de pages (pour l’instant seule la page auteur a une variante)(nécessite le plugin "compositions")
-  Modification de l’apparence graphique du site (couleurs, typographie et images de fond)(via le plugin CFG )
-  ajout du formulaire de contact auteur ;
-  affichage de l’article si la rubrique n’en compte qu’un seul.(ok, mais nécessite le plugin "compositions")

N’hésitez pas à indiquer dans les commentaires si vous utilisez ces squelettes et les améliorations éventuelles qui pourraient être utiles.

Mise à jour : Le site de démonstration est désormais utilisé pour le développement collaboratif du squelette. N’hésitez pas à y contribuer.

Voir en ligne : Squelette The Morning After : site de démonstration

Portfolio

Sommaire Rubrique Article

Notes

[1] Mise à jour : depuis l’adaptation sous SPIP, l’auteur a changé l’emplacement de téléchargement du thème qui est désormais http://themasterplan.in/tma. La licence de la nouvelle version du thème est différente également.

[2] Selon Wikipedia : cette licence « est une licence de logiciel libre et Open Source. Elle donne à toute personne recevant le logiciel le droit illimité de l’utiliser, le copier, le modifier, le fusionner, le publier, le distribuer, le vendre et de changer sa licence. La seule obligation est de mettre le nom des auteurs avec la notice de copyright.

Elle est très proche de la nouvelle licence BSD, seule la dernière clause diffère. Elle est compatible avec la GNU General Public License. »

Le jeu de squelette comporte le fichier README d’origine avec une copie de la licence. L’auteur demande de conserver la mention de copyright dans le footer, au moins sous forme de commentaire. Un lien vers son site et vers le site spip.net sont aussi présents dans le footer.

[3] Pour préciser par exemple le gourpe de mots clés utilisés pour vos tags avec la syntaxe [(#MODELE{nuage}{id=4})] si vos tags sont dans la rubrique 4.

[4] les évolutions rayées sont disponibles dans le paquet "en travaux"

Retour en haut de la page

220 Messages de forum

Voir toute la discussion

Pages 1 | 2 | 3 | 4 | 5 | 6 | 7 | 8 | 9 | ...

  • Répondre à ce message

    3 janvier 16:15, par Jean-Marc

    Bonjour et meilleurs voeux pour 2010,

    je souhaiterai que le texte du "chapeau" des différents articles apparaissent en gras à la lecture des articles. Quelle est la procédure à suivre ? Merci. Jean-Marc

  • Répondre à ce message

    7 décembre 2009 22:23, par Jean-Marc

    Bonsoir, aller dans le dossier "lang" et ouvrir le ficher "fr" et apporter les modifs souhaitées. Jean-Marc

  • Répondre à ce message

    1er décembre 2009 21:07

    Bonjour,

    c’est une fausse solution en vérité. J’ai remplacé #INTRODUCTION par #TEXTE => du coup ça affiche tout, mais ça ne me convient que parce que les textes sont par essence des textes courts, ce sont des brèves. Si quelqu’un a mieux, je suis preneur !

  • Répondre à ce message

    1er décembre 2009 14:10, par ed

    bonjour,

    ai meme probléme, mais moi je n’y suis tjs pas arrivé. J’ai vu que vous aviez la solution...pourriez vous m’expliquer comment cela fonctionne !!!

    merci encore

  • Répondre à ce message

    30 novembre 2009 18:51

    Bonjour,

    je ne savais effectivement pas que #INTRODUCTION ne permettait pas cela. Ni #CHAPO, ni #DESCRIPTIF ne permettent d’afficher tout ou partie du corps du texte. Reste #TEXTE avec un couper ?? mais la balise avec ce critère réagit comme avec #INTRODUCTION -> pas de lien dans le texte. Comme ce sont des brèves, je me contenterai de la balise #TEXTE mais ce ne serait pas satisfaisant sinon...

  • Répondre à ce message

    30 novembre 2009 13:30, par Valéry

    Je crois qu’il s’agit du comportement par défaut de la balise #INTRODUCTION : une alternative serait de la remplacer par #CHAPO ou #DESCRIPTIF dans sommaire.html.

    À ce que j’en ai compris, comme #INTRODUCTION coupe arbitrairement à 600 caractères le contenu (par défaut) la balise ne peut garantir l’intégrité d’un lien. Le filtre |couper doit a priori se comporter de la même manière.

    Doc une autre balise sans filtre devrait permettre un fonctionnement des liens. Ensuite naturellement il faut une certaine modération dans la quantité de texte saisie dans les champs correspondant.

  • Répondre à ce message

    30 novembre 2009 13:12

    Bonjour,

    un truc agaçant : les liens que l’on définit dans le corps du texte, que ce soit dans les brèves ou les articles, ne sont pas actifs sur la page d’accueil alors qu’ils le sont sur la page article.html ou sur la page breve.html, comment résoudre cette petite contrariété ? Merci.

  • Répondre à ce message

    26 novembre 2009 21:19, par Jean-Marc

    Bonsoir, je souhaite mettre le pavé publicitaire SPIP dans la deuxième colonne entre les derniers billets et le browse. Peux-tu me rappeler la procédure. Merci Jean-Marc

  • Répondre à ce message

    26 novembre 2009 13:46, par eric

    désolé, j’ai beugué... et t’oublies pas d’y mettre les crochets avant et aprés et cela doit fonctionner INCLUREfond=inc-ad_home

  • Répondre à ce message

    26 novembre 2009 13:39, par eric

    salut, dans le fichier sommaire.html, tu copies ces deux lignes de code à l’endroi que tu souhaites

    —>

    pour changer l’image et le lien tu édites le fichier inc-ad_home et tu modifie image et lien, puis dans le dossier images tu y depose ta nouvelle photo. Normalement cela fonctionne

    http://www.tkdlongages.fr

    moi je l’ai mise en haut à droite

Pages 1 | 2 | 3 | 4 | 5 | 6 | 7 | 8 | 9 | ...

Répondre à cet article

Retour en haut de la page

Ça discute par ici

  • Formulaire de participation à un événement

    23 janvier – 17 commentaires

    Cet article tente de rassembler des informations au sujet de l’affichage d’un formulaire de participation aux événements gérés par le plugin Agenda développé par Cédric Morin. La version 2 du plugin Agenda permet d’afficher dans l’espace public des (...)

  • Le Squelette Zpip

    11 novembre 2009 – 119 commentaires

    Zpip [1] est un squelette réutilisable, modulaire et disposant d’une galerie de thèmes. Il est issu d’une fusion des projets Zesty et SPIP-Zen. Installer Zpip Pour installer Zpip et jouer avec sans plus attendre, il suffit de suivre le guide (...)

  • Plugin Pages uniques

    11 décembre 2008 – 74 commentaires

    Allez, avouez... il ne vous est jamais arrivé d’avoir besoin d’articles qui ne sont rattachés à aucun rubriquage particulier ? Des articles uniques, n’ayant ni de thème, ni de rapport avec aucun autre ? Ou encore des articles pour lesquels vous avez (...)

  • Le Couteau Suisse

    4 mai 2007 – 835 commentaires

    Ce plugin propose d’introduire facilement de simples fonctionnalités supplémentaires à SPIP et qui s’avèrent rapidement indispensables ! Par exemple : des filtres supplémentaires, des balises pratiques, des facilités typographiques, le contrôle de (...)

  • Squelette Median

    22 juin 2009 – 77 commentaires

    Un squelette généraliste, valide XHTML, et configurable. Sites de démonstration : en es fr